BCHC To Host Volunteer Orientation In September

August 20, 2024 | 0 Comments

Bermuda Cancer and Health Centre invites members of the community to attend an upcoming Volunteer Orientation on Wednesday, 18th September, at 5:30 pm.

A spokesperson said, “This event will be held at the Centre’s main facility and is open to both new and returning volunteers who are eager to make a meaningful difference in the lives of those affected by cancer and other chronic illnesses.

“Volunteering at Bermuda Cancer and Health Centre is more than just offering your time; it’s about becoming a part of a compassionate and supportive community. Volunteers play a crucial role in enhancing the Centre’s ability to provide exceptional care and services, from patient support and administrative tasks to community outreach and event assistance.”

Maria McLeod-Smith, the Volunteer and Fundraising Manager at Bermuda Cancer and Health Centre, shared her thoughts on the importance of volunteering, “Volunteering is more than just helping out—it’s about connecting with others, spreading hope, and making Bermuda a better, healthier place.”

She added, “We’re really looking forward to welcoming both new and returning volunteers to our orientation and showing them how much of an impact they can have.”

The spokesperson said, “The Volunteer Orientation will offer attendees an overview of the Centre’s mission, the various volunteer roles available, and the impact that its service has on the community. It will also provide an opportunity to ask questions and learn how to get involved.

Event Details:

  • What: Volunteer Orientation
  • When: Wednesday, 18th September, 5:30 pm
  • Where: Bermuda Cancer and Health Centre, 46 Point Finger Road, Paget.
